Everybody is so creative, but not everybody is so nice. Tom Sachs is an artworld darling with his own production studio, deals with Nike, and lots of servants who work for him in order to be close to the creative fire that burns bright within his darling-artworld-mind. Oh wait, not servants but staff. No, not staff, employees. Whatever you call them it doesn't matter because they don't matter. At least that's the story that comes out of studio.
Tom Sachs is accused of underpaying and undervaluing his employees while at the same time being the poster-boy for liberal values and wokeness. The gossip that Tom isn't so nice hurt his deal with Nike (can anyone say Kanye?) and Tom decided he'd better speak up and address the criticism by way of offering a public apology.
Tom's a creative genius, can he apologize his way back into the Met Gala?
